In today’s world, cloud computing is changing how we use technology. It lets businesses and people access and manage their tech resources over the internet. This means they don’t have to rely on just what’s in front of them.
At its heart, cloud computing offers services like servers, storage, databases, software, analytics, and more when you need them. These services are taken care of by experts who let users access them without having to own or look after the equipment.
The good points of cloud computing are many. They include making things easier to change, offering more ways to work together, and making access easy from anywhere. This type of technology means businesses can grow or shrink their tech needs quickly, which is better for their bottom line.
Key Takeaways
- Cloud computing means using tech services online when you need them.
- These services include everything from servers to analysis tools, all run by experts.
- It offers benefits such as being able to change quickly, work together better, and access things from anywhere.
- This tech makes it easier for organizations to adjust their tech, save money, and work more effectively.
- There are different ways to use cloud computing, such as Software as a Service (SaaS), Platform as a Service (PaaS), or Infrastructure as a Service (IaaS).
Introduction to Cloud Computing
Cloud computing has changed how we use and store our digital items. This new tech has impacted the way businesses work. It makes it easy for any business, big or small, to use powerful tools, store more data, and work together better.
Also Read : How Do I Get Affordable Dental Insurance?
To understand this change, we’ll learn about cloud computing, its changes over time, and what it does for us.
Definition of Cloud Computing
Cloud computing means getting computer services over the internet. These services include servers, storage, and software. Users can get to these services without needing their own hardware or setup.
Also Read : How Does Property Insurance Protect Against Natural Disasters?
This way of computing means not being tied down by physical things. It makes life easier and more cost-effective for businesses and people.
Also Read : What Are The Benefits And Drawbacks Of Using Communication Technology In Education?
Evolution of Cloud Computing
Cloud computing has changed a lot as technology got better. The need for remote work and better data control pushed it forward. It started by letting users access outside computing power. Now, it brings us lots of services, like software, platforms, and infrastructure.
Also Read : How Can University Courses Online Help You Achieve Your Career Goals?
This change has helped businesses run better, spend less, and be more flexible with technology.
Benefits of Cloud Computing
There are many good things about cloud computing. One key benefit is how it can adjust to what a business needs. This means saving money and always having the right amount of resources.
Also Read : What Qualifications Are Required For State Government Jobs In The Usa?
It also cuts down on costs by not needing lots of hardware on-site. Working together and accessing data from anywhere is easier. Plus, keeping data safe and ready for an emergency is better too.
As more places use cloud computing, they find new ways to work and get ahead. It’s making work more efficient, safe, and available from anywhere.
Types of Cloud Services
In the cloud computing world, there are three main service models: Software-as-a-Service (SaaS), Platform-as-a-Service (PaaS), and Infrastructure-as-a-Service (IaaS). It’s key for companies to know the differences. This helps them choose the best solutions for their needs.
Software-as-a-Service (SaaS)
SaaS is a top cloud service model, giving users access to apps through a browser or app. You don’t need to install these apps on your device. Businesses can use many cloud computing services by paying a subscription fee. They find applications for customer management (CRM), productivity, planning, and human resources.
Platform-as-a-Service (PaaS)
PaaS helps make, test, launch, and manage web apps and services in the cloud. It gives developers tools and infrastructure to create and grow apps. They don’t have to worry about the servers, databases, or operating systems underneath.
Infrastructure-as-a-Service (IaaS)
IaaS provides virtual storage, servers, and networks. It lets businesses rent their IT needs. They can change their computing power and storage whenever without having to look after physical machines.
Cloud Service Model | Definition | Key Characteristics | Examples |
---|---|---|---|
Software-as-a-Service (SaaS) | Cloud-based software delivery model where applications are hosted and managed by the provider |
|
|
Platform-as-a-Service (PaaS) | Cloud-based environment for developing, testing, deploying, and managing applications |
|
|
Infrastructure-as-a-Service (IaaS) | Provides access to virtualized computing resources, including storage, servers, and networking |
|
|
Know the features of cloud service types to choose the best for business needs. Whether it’s for smoother operations (SaaS), faster app development (PaaS), or easier IT growth (IaaS).
Cloud Deployment Models
The cloud has several models designed to fit various organizational needs. There’s the public cloud, private cloud, and hybrid cloud. The multi-cloud strategy is also now being used.
Public Cloud
The public cloud gives you online access to servers, data storage, and more.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form are big names in this. It’s known for being scalable, affordable, and easy to use.
Private Cloud
The private cloud is just for one organization. It can be at the organization’s location or in a dedicated data center. This model offers more control and security. It’s great for those with strict rules or who want full control.
Hybrid Cloud
With a hybrid cloud, companies mix public and private clouds. They get the best of both worlds. This setup allows for moving data between clouds easily.
Multi-Cloud Approach
Some companies also choose a multi-cloud strategy, using services from various providers. This approach boosts flexibility and avoids dependency on just one provider. It enhances performance and flexibility.
Deployment Model | Description | Key Characteristics |
---|---|---|
Public Cloud | Cloud resources and services are provided by a third-party vendor over the internet. | Scalable, cost-effective, accessible, managed by the cloud provider. |
Private Cloud | Dedicated cloud environment for a single organization, hosted on-premises or by a third-party. | Higher control, customization, and security, managed by the organization. |
Hybrid Cloud | Combination of public and private cloud models, integrating both environments. | Leverages the benefits of public and private clouds, offers flexibility and data portability. |
Multi-Cloud | Utilization of multiple public cloud services from different providers. | Increased flexibility, redundancy, and optimization of cloud resources, reduced vendor lock-in. |
Cloud Computing
Cloud computing means using services delivered over the internet. This includes servers, databases, software, networks, analytics, and more. You can use these through the cloud. This lets you access files and programs from any place.
Experts say cloud computing is a great way for all kinds of businesses to handle their needs. It lets companies adjust their computing power, work together better, save money, and work more efficiently. The cloud computing definition is delivering computing needs on-demand through the internet, like storage and software.
Cloud computing works by sharing resources like servers, storage, and software. Users can get what they need without worrying about the infrastructure. This option is great for companies wanting to cut down on IT work and focus on their goals.
In short, cloud computing has changed how we use technology to do business and personal tasks. It’s flexible, can grow with your needs, and is cost-efficient. By knowing the definition of cloud computing and how cloud computing works, companies can use it for success and innovation.
Cloud Security Measures
More and more, companies are using cloud computing. Yet, keeping data safe is a big worry. For this, they need the right cloud security measures. These tools help keep information safe, follow the rules, and face new cloud security challenges and cloud security risks.
Data Encryption
One key step is to use strong data encryption. This means locking up data so only the right people can see it. Cloud providers have different ways to do this, like data-at-rest encryption and data-in-transit encryption. That’s how they keep cloud data security tight and stop the bad guys from getting in.
Access Controls
It’s also critical to control who can get to what. This is done through access controls. Cloud companies have many tools for this. They use things like multi-factor checks, setting roles, and managing permissions closely. This ensures only the people who should see your data, do.
Compliance and Regulations
Sticking to the right rules is key for cloud users. Cloud providers work hard to keep their end safe and follow the law. They are checked often to meet rules like HIPAA, GDPR, and PCI-DSS. This helps cloud users stay on the right side of the compliance regulations.
Cloud Storage Solutions
In today’s digital world, the need for reliable data storage is more important than ever. Cloud storage solutions have changed how we handle our digital information. These options make data more accessible, secure, and scalable. They meet the growing needs of storing data in the cloud.
Object Storage
Object storage organizes data as objects with unique details. It’s great for huge amounts of varied data, like pictures and videos, since it’s very flexible. Systems like Amazon S3 and Google Cloud Storage work well with the massive data in the cloud. They offer long-lasting storage at a lower price.
File Storage
File storage, or NAS, gives a central place to store and get files from. Cloud options like Microsoft OneDrive and Dropbox are perfect for group work. They allow easy sharing, accessible from anywhere, and safe backups. This makes them a top choice for teamwork on documents, presentations, and more.
Block Storage
Block storage breaks data into fixed-size parts, great for specific tasks like database work. Services such as Amazon EBS and Google Persistent Disk are fast and reliable. They serve big job sites well, offering strong, scalable storage for business needs.
Cloud Storage Type | Key Features | Best Suited For |
---|---|---|
Object Storage |
|
|
File Storage |
|
|
Block Storage |
|
|
Knowing the benefits of each cloud storage type helps companies improve their data usage. It boosts their efficiency and competitiveness in the digital world.
Cloud Networking Basics
More and more, businesses use cloud computing for their work. Having good cloud network solutions is very important. These solutions help make sure the cloud works well, connects well, and services run smoothly.
Virtual Private Cloud (VPC)
A virtual private cloud (VPC) is like a private section in a public cloud. It lets companies control their network, security, and who can access what. With a VPC, they can set their own IP addresses, subnets, and other network settings. This makes a safe and private space in the cloud that works well with things they already have.
Load Balancing
Load balancing shares incoming work across different servers or resources. It helps make sure everything runs smoothly. This way, the work can be divided well, apps work better, and there’s more safety if something goes wrong. Cloud load balancing can also change size, switch automatically, and route traffic smartly. This keeps things running smoothly even when there’s a lot going on.
Content Delivery Networks (CDNs)
Content Delivery Networks (CDNs) are key for getting web pages, images, and videos to people quickly. They store this content in many places around the world. This lowers the time it takes to get to the users. CDNs help make the web faster and better for everyone, no matter where they are. They also take some pressure off the main cloud services, making everything work better.
Cloud Networking Feature | Description | Key Benefits |
---|---|---|
Virtual Private Cloud (VPC) | A private, isolated section of a public cloud that allows organizations to maintain control over their network architecture, security, and access. | Enhanced cloud network security, seamless integration of on-premises resources with cloud-based infrastructure. |
Load Balancing | Distributes incoming traffic across multiple servers or resources, ensuring optimal resource utilization, improved application performance, and enhanced fault tolerance. | Maintains high availability and responsiveness of cloud-hosted applications, dynamic scaling, automatic failover, and intelligent traffic routing. |
Content Delivery Networks (CDNs) | Cache content at multiple geographically distributed edge locations to reduce latency, improve cloud connectivity, and enhance the user experience. | Offload traffic from the core cloud infrastructure, improving overall cloud infrastructure networking and reducing the load on cloud resources. |
Cloud Providers and Platforms
The cloud computing industry is growing fast. Several big cloud providers now lead the way. They give many cloud computing platforms and enterprise cloud services. These help both small and big businesses with strong security and room to grow.
Amazon Web Services (AWS)
Amazon Web Services (AWS) is the biggest cloud service provider out there. It’s helped start a revolution in cloud computing. AWS has lots of tools for different needs: from storing data to managing networks.
Microsoft Azure
Microsoft Azure is also big in cloud services. It works well with other Microsoft products. This makes it a top choice for companies that already use Microsoft tech.
Google Cloud Platform
Google Cloud Platform (GCP) is known for its innovation and strong security. It offers services like AI, machine learning, and data crunching. GCP is great for companies who want to grow with advanced technology.
Cloud Provider | Key Offerings | Strengths |
---|---|---|
Amazon Web Services (AWS) | Compute, storage, databases, networking, analytics, AI/ML, IoT, and more | Largest and most comprehensive cloud platform, market leader, wide range of services, strong ecosystem |
Microsoft Azure | Compute, storage, databases, networking, analytics, AI/ML, IoT, and more | Seamless integration with Microsoft ecosystem, enterprise-grade features, strong hybrid cloud capabilities |
Google Cloud Platform (GCP) | Compute, storage, databases, networking, analytics, AI/ML, IoT, and more | Cutting-edge technologies, focus on innovation, strong security features, competitive pricing |
The top cloud providers offer many services to help businesses change and grow digitally.
Cloud Architecture and Technologies
Businesses today are using the latest cloud architecture and cloud technologies to work smarter and faster. They’re focusing on areas like virtualization, containerization, and serverless computing to make big changes.
Virtualization
Virtualization makes virtual machines (VMs) possible. It’s all about creating virtual versions of IT essentials, like servers, storage, and networks. This means companies can do more with their cloud infrastructure and cloud services, saving money and being more flexible. Virtualization fits well in private clouds, giving tight control, tailored solutions, and flexible resource scaling.
Containerization
Containerization is a modern option to virtualization, designed for easier and more flexible app use. It wraps an app, its settings, and the run-time into a container, making it easy to move the app across cloud platforms and cloud services. This method really boosts how portable, flexible, and dependable apps are, which teams love for cloud-native work and DevOps.
Serverless Computing
Serverless computing takes away the need to deal with servers. It’s a cloud setup where developers just work on their apps, not the backend. The cloud provider looks after everything, offering more speed, less to worry about, and pay-as-you-go plans. It’s great for small tasks, microservices, and using functions as needed.
Cloud Trends and Use Cases
The cloud computing world is changing fast, and new trends and uses are popping up. These changes are creating new ways for businesses to work. They range from using big data and advanced analytics to the Internet of Things (IoT) and artificial intelligence (AI). This makes the cloud a hub for innovative solutions in many fields.
Cloud for Big Data and Analytics
The cloud is great for big data and analytics. Its scalable and flexible nature fits well with managing and analyzing huge datasets. This helps businesses find important insights, make better decisions, and get ahead of the competition.
Cloud tools for data work, storage, and seeing trends allow quick growth. They let companies get valuable intelligence from their data. All this happens while using the cloud’s lower costs and high security.
Cloud for Internet of Things (IoT)
The Internet of Things (IoT) is relying heavily on cloud services. The cloud can handle the massive amount of data from IoT devices. It supports real-time updates and monitors devices from anywhere. This makes IoT projects more efficient and creates better experiences for customers.
Using the cloud for IoT means companies can easily collect, process, and use data from their devices. This leads to smoother operations and the chance to make new IoT-driven products and services.
Cloud for Artificial Intelligence and Machine Learning
The cloud is a key part in the fast growth of artificial intelligence (AI) and machine learning (ML). It offers big computing power and access to lots of data. This is driving the quick progress in AI and ML. Now, companies, big and small, can use advanced AI and ML without big barriers.
Also read: How Is Artificial Intelligence Transforming Everyday Life?
Conclusion
The article has given us a deep look at cloud computing. It discusses what it is, how it has evolved, and its benefits for businesses today. These advantages include better efficiency, growth opportunities, and improved teamwork, even from far away. Cloud computing is now key for running a modern business.
More and more organizations are choosing cloud solutions. But, they face specific challenges like keeping their data safe. Yet, cloud computing lets companies be more innovative and undergo digital change. This is happening in many sectors, thanks to the cloud’s potential.
The future of cloud computing looks promising. New trends like using big data, analytics, the Internet of Things (IoT), and artificial intelligence (AI) are on the rise. These will bring even more progress in cloud technology. By following these trends, businesses can thrive in the digital world.
FAQs
What is cloud computing?
Cloud computing means using services on the internet. These services include servers, databases, and software that you can access online. This allows you to reach your files and programs from anywhere, making it unnecessary to carry hardware with you.
What are the main types of cloud services?
Cloud computing has three main categories: software-as-a-service (SaaS), platform-as-a-service (PaaS), and infrastructure-as-a-service (IaaS). SaaS lets you use software through a web browser. PaaS helps with building and running web apps. IaaS offers computer basics like storage and servers online.
What are the different cloud deployment models?
The different ways to use cloud computing are private, public, and hybrid cloud. Private cloud is just for one business. Public cloud is on the internet for anyone to use. Hybrid cloud mixes the two, letting organizations keep parts private while sharing others. Organizations can also choose to use more than one public cloud, spreading their workloads.
How does cloud computing improve security?
Cloud companies put strong security measures in place, but users need to protect their own data too. It’s important to pick services with good security features, like firewalls and encryption. These help keep data safe.
How does cloud storage work?
Cloud storage means files and programs are online, not on your devices. You can access them from anywhere. Before, we saved work on physical drives. Now, we don’t worry about losing our work because it’s in the cloud. The data is saved on servers that are connected to the internet.
What are the leading cloud providers and platforms?
Companies like Amazon Web Services (AWS), Microsoft Azure, and Google Cloud offer secure, public cloud services. They take steps to protect your data from others who are using the same services. Always look for services with rigorous security measures.
What are the key cloud architecture and technologies?
Cloud technology includes key aspects like virtualization, containerization, and serverless computing. Virtualization makes virtual machines, containerization lets you package your apps, and serverless means you don’t have to worry about managing servers.
What are some of the top cloud computing use cases and trends?
There are many uses for cloud services, from big data and IoT to AI and digital transformation. Remote work and disaster recovery are also key applications. The cloud market in the U.S. is growing fast, especially due to more people working remotely. It’s expected to keep growing at a fast rate.